What happens after a deal closes? For many sellers, the biggest risk isn’t valuation or buyer interest—it’s the risks and exposures uncovered too late in the process.
Selling a business involves more thanjust finding the right buyer or achieving a strong valuation. Insurance and risk decisions made early in the M&A process can influence deal structure, negotiations, diligence timelines, and impact outcomes long after closing. When these issues surface late, sellers may face delayed closings or unexpected post-close liability.

What You’ll Learn
Deal Readiness: What buyers look for from an insurance standpoint and why addressing it early matters.
Risk Transfer: How representations & warranties insurance (RWI) helps shift risk away from sellers during a transaction.
Post-Close Protection: What tail (run-off) coverage is and why it can protect sellers after the deal is done.
Forward Risk: Emerging risks buyers are underwriting, and steps sellers can take to reduce concern.
